Best Time to Visit Hoima, Uganda
Hoima experiences a tropical climate, characterized by two distinct seasons - the dry season and the wet season. The best time to visit Hoima is during the dry season, which typically runs from December to February and June to August. During these months, the weather is warm and pleasant, making it ideal for outdoor activities and exploration.
The average temperature in Hoima ranges from 25°C (77°F) to 30°C (86°F) throughout the year. However, it is important to note that temperatures can vary depending on the time of day and elevation. It is advisable to pack lightweight and breathable clothing, as well as sunscreen and a hat, to protect yourself from the sun.

3. Explore the Kibiro Salt Gardens
Discover the ancient Kibiro Salt Gardens, a unique attraction that dates back centuries. These salt gardens are located on the shores of Lake Albert and are still actively used by the local community. Learn about the traditional salt extraction methods and witness the stunning views of the lake.

1. Karuzika Palace
Visit the Karuzika Palace, a magnificent architectural masterpiece that serves as the official residence of the Omukama (King) of Bunyoro. Admire the intricate designs and learn about the history of the Bunyoro Kingdom.

What is the currency used in Hoima, Uganda?
The official currency of Uganda is the Ugandan Shilling (UGX). It is advisable to carry some local currency for small purchases, as not all establishments accept credit cards.
Are there any safety concerns in Hoima?
Hoima is generally a safe city for tourists. However, it is always recommended to take necessary precautions, such as avoiding isolated areas at night and keeping your belongings secure.
How do I get to Hoima?
Hoima is accessible by road from major cities in Uganda. The nearest airport is Entebbe International Airport, located approximately 230 kilometers away. From the airport, you can hire a private car or take a public bus to reach Hoima.
What is the official language spoken in Hoima?
The official language of Uganda is English. However, the local language spoken in Hoima is Runyoro, which is widely understood by the residents.
